Built approx. 45 years ago, we are delighted to offer for sale this prime opportunity to purchase a substantial 4 bedroom, 3 reception detached family home which has planning permission granted to remodel if required. Planning Ref 24/P/01606. Plans available on request.

The current accommodation includes a generous entrance hall with the double aspect lounge, having a conservatory to the rear, The separate dining room is light and airy and has a picture window overlooking the rear gardens.

The kitchen is fitted with a range of wall and floor units, with a useful cloakroom and large integral double garage completing the ground floor spaces.

To the first floor are four good sized bedrooms, with an ensuite to the main bedroom and family bathroom.

Outside, the rear gardens are a true delight, being mainly laid to lawn with mature trees and shrubs for all year round privacy and offering scope for the budding gardening enthusiast, whilst to the front there is a generous driveway with parking for numerous vehicles and access to the garage.

The property is located in this popular and secluded cul-de-sac, located within a mile walk of Horsley station (Waterloo 42 mins) and within catchment The Howard of Effingham School, making this an ideal purchase for the growing family.

East and West Horsley form charming villages, set on the edge of the Surrey Hills AONB. This village community provides local independent shops, cafes and deli's, popular pubs and wonderful walking, right on your doorstep. The area benefits from popular, highly rated schools, regular train services to London Waterloo (45 mins) and active community activities. History abounds with West Horsley Place, Horsley Towers and the Ada Lovelace connection and the renowned Chown built homes that give a unique character. Excellent facilities are provided with Squires Garden Centre, Nomad Theatre, Grange Park Opera, The Drift Golf club and at the end of 2026, a new private members gym and fitness centre.
